A FINE DRIVE. Mr. Boyd Edkins, the well-known X.SS.W. motorist, has succeeded in establishing a particularly fine drive under adverse road conditions over the Interstate route between Brisbane and Sydney. a distance of 037 miles. Owing' to recent heavy rains in Queensland', Air. Edkins was nearly abandoning bis proposed attempt on the existing figures, but decided to tackle Mr. F. Birtles' record of 2!) hours 35 minutes, despite the fact that the road was well n igli impossible in places. He left Brisbane at 2 a.m. Friday and arrived at Sydney at .! minutes past 4 nil Saturday morning, his time for the journey bein" ■■ hours 3 minutes, exactly Hi 'hours "better than the previous record. Many delays occurred on the journey, and' considerable time was lost owing to breakages. Tfc was a remarkable fdat to get through at all m the circumstances. Mr. J'.dkms mount was a 2"> h.p Prince Henry '■Vauxhall," shod with T>unlon tyres which came through the r>niellip'<r drive without being touched. Air. Ed" kins is the present, holder of |h, bourne-Sydney (3(1:, record which stands at 1(S hours sr. minutes, one of (■lie greatest drives yet recorded in this country.
